Top Coworking Hubs in Dubai

Dubai, being a global business hub, offers an impressive array of coworking spaces. They cater to various industries and preferences.

AstroLabs in Jumeirah Lakes Towers (JLT) is a prominent choice. It’s especially popular among tech startups. They offer 24/7 access. The community is focused on digital innovation. It provides mentorship. This makes it a vibrant ecosystem.

For a more artistic vibe, A4 Space by Alserkal Avenue is unique. Located in Al Quoz, it offers a free coworking area. This makes it accessible. It is popular among creatives. It also hosts art exhibitions. This blend of work and culture is inspiring.

Nook Coworking stands out. It focuses on fitness, sports, and wellness sectors. It’s partnered with DMCC Free Zone. Members can access a supportive community. It offers all essential office amenities. This niche focus attracts specific professionals.

Nest Dubai in Barsha Heights is another excellent option. It’s integrated within the TRYP by Wyndham hotel. It provides a professional setting. It has various meeting room options. It is suitable for diverse work needs. Its hotel integration offers extra convenience.

Other notable spaces include Regus with multiple locations. They offer professional serviced offices. The Bureau Dubai is known for its female-focused community, welcoming everyone. Dtec (Dubai Technology Entrepreneur Campus) in Dubai Silicon Oasis supports tech entrepreneurs. These choices highlight Dubai’s dynamic work environment.

Leading Coworking Spaces in Abu Dhabi

Abu Dhabi also boasts a growing number of high-quality coworking spaces. They cater to its evolving business landscape.

WeWork Hub71 is a significant player. It is located within the Hub71 ecosystem. This space connects members to a global network. It provides top-tier facilities. It is ideal for startups and tech companies. Its scale and resources are impressive.

Cloud Spaces in Yas Mall offers a dynamic experience. It blends work with leisure opportunities. It has stylish, tech-savvy offices. They aim to promote productivity. It also hosts events. This enhances networking within the community.

Servcorp Etihad Towers provides a luxurious option. It offers prestigious business addresses. The facilities are well-equipped. It caters to established businesses and professionals. Its prime location adds to its appeal.

Haibu Space Coworking in Abu Dhabi Mall creates an energetic environment. It fosters creativity. It is suitable for freelancers and startups. Its vibrant atmosphere encourages collaboration. It is centrally located.

GlassQube Coworking is one of the largest ecosystems. It offers flexible and affordable spaces. They cater to startups and SMEs. Their multiple locations provide convenience. These spaces support Abu Dhabi’s economic diversification.

Notable Coworking Spots in Sharjah

Sharjah, with its focus on education and culture, also provides unique coworking opportunities. They cater to a diverse community.

Fikra Campus is a design-led communal space. It brings together creatives and entrepreneurs. It features a coworking area. It also includes a design studio and gallery. This makes it a hub for innovation. It supports artistic endeavors.

Lammah Space focuses on a professional yet welcoming environment. It caters to students and professionals. It offers flexible membership options. It also hosts private events and workshops. This space supports a wide range of needs.

Sharjah Research, Technology and Innovation Park (SRTIP) also features coworking facilities. This area is dedicated to fostering innovation. It attracts researchers and tech companies. The environment is highly collaborative. It supports groundbreaking projects.

Regus also has a presence in Sharjah. They offer reliable and well-equipped workspaces. Their global network adds value. These spaces contribute to Sharjah’s evolving business landscape. They support local talent.

Choosing Your Ideal Coworking Space

Selecting the best coworking space for your needs involves careful consideration. What works for one person might not suit another.

Firstly, think about location. Choose a space convenient for your commute. Consider its proximity to clients or business partners. Locations near metro stations or major roads are often preferred. For example, spaces in Downtown Dubai or Business Bay offer strategic access.

Secondly, assess the amenities and services. High-speed internet is a given. But do you need private meeting rooms? Is a phone booth essential for calls? Some spaces offer fitness centers, cafes, or even postal services. Consider what extras enhance your productivity.

Thirdly, evaluate the community and atmosphere. Do you prefer a quiet, focused environment? Or a lively, collaborative one? Visit potential spaces. Talk to current members. This helps gauge the vibe. Some spaces are industry-specific. Others are more general.

Lastly, consider membership plans and costs. Coworking spaces offer various packages. Hot desks provide flexible seating. Dedicated desks give you a permanent spot. Private offices offer more privacy. Prices vary significantly. Hot desks might range from approximately AED 500 to AED 1,200 per month. Dedicated desks might be around AED 1,200 to AED 2,000 monthly. Private offices can range from AED 2,200 to AED 7,000+ per month, depending on size and location. These are approximate figures. Always check current pricing.
